WAXAHACHIE - Official Dallas Cowboy Cheerleader trainer, Jay Johnson, is bringing his famous fitness program—and some Dallas Cowboy Cheerleaders—to Waxahachie this month to benefit the Waxahachie High School Cherokee Charmers.
Jay’s Boot Camp, a four-week fitness program, is tailored to all levels of fitness to help every participant kick start their personal fitness routine and learn how to stay in shape through healthy living.
Sponsored by the Cherokee Charmer Booster Club and Taco Cabana Catering, Jay’s Boot Camp is offering a significant discount.
The program, typically $225, will be just $120 for a four-week workout.
The event will be held from 7 – 8 p.m. on Monday and Wednesday evenings from Monday, July 25 – Wednesday, Aug. 17 at the Howard Junior High School at 265 Broadhead Road.
The program is open to men and women of all ages who want to get in shape.
Space is limited and advanced registration is required.
